Transaction 641508635ec0f206159a75a50a79d58a252f2e194790c70b7754db9e5a0a1880
1 Input
1 Output
-
641508635ec0f206159a75a50a79d58a252f2e194790c70b7754db9e5a0a1880:0
- value
- 13624989
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c6df2940cfbb9f681447328b0443bc5d20d7e3d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q1izdgcRGwnMrm9od8DjoZzzxMgjWyrjG